The vast stone-paved plaza at the heart of Tirana takes its name from the equestrian statue of Skanderbeg at its centre, ringed by the National History Museum, the Et'hem Bey Mosque and the clock tower — landmarks that together read like a condensed timeline of the city. Locals treat it as an everyday gathering point rather than a museum piece: free Wi-Fi draws lingering visitors, a giant Albanian flag flies at one edge, and a Christmas tree transforms the square each winter. With nearly 14,000 reviews and a 4.5 average, it's less a single sight than the stage where Tirana's daily life plays out.
